Instructions
Soften Cream Cheese: Cube the cream cheese, spread it on a plate, and microwave for 20-25 seconds, until very soft. Transfer it to a large bowl, then beat until very smooth using a hand mixer.
Add Ingredients: Add the yogurt, thawed orange juice concentrate, and vanilla extract, and beat until smooth.
For a silkier, thinner dip (not fluffy-pictured): Transfer the fluff to a bowl and microwave for 10 seconds.Beat the fluff into the other ingredients until smooth.
For a fluffier dip: Fold in the fluff until combined, noting the more you stir, the more air is released, resulting in a dip that’s less fluffy.
Chill: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, but best if overnight. Serve with assorted fruits and dippers. Store in the refrigerator for 3-5 days.

FLAVOR VARIATIONS
Use Lemon Instead of the OJ Concentrate: Use 1-2 teaspoons of lemon zest, or the next best option is one teaspoon of lemon extract.
Flavored Cream Cheese: Use strawberry, blueberry, or honey walnut cream cheese to instantly transform the flavor without adding extra ingredients.
Flavored Jell-O: Add 1-2 tablespoons of the dry powder (to taste) for a pop of color and flavor. Flavors such as strawberry, raspberry, lime, cherry, orange and peach would be tasty.
Berry Bliss: Mix in crushed raspberries or diced strawberries for a fruity flavor boost and pretty pink hue.
Tropical Treat: Mix in some cream of coconut (used in drinks, NOT coconut cream-see Amazon HERE) and/or a splash of pineapple juice for a beachy twist.
Nutella Twist: Omit the yogurt and add Nutella (softened) for a rich, chocolate-hazelnut dip that's irresistible with strawberries, bananas, and apples.
Peanut Butter Fluff: Swirl in a spoonful of creamy peanut butter for a sweet and salty combo, especially delicious with apples and pretzels.
Spiced Up: Add a pinch of cinnamon or pumpkin pie spice for cozy, warm flavors—perfect for fall with apples.
